diff options
author | Hidetoshi Seto <seto.hidetoshi@jp.fujitsu.com> | 2009-05-27 22:41:01 -0400 |
---|---|---|
committer | H. Peter Anvin <hpa@zytor.com> | 2009-05-28 12:24:16 -0400 |
commit | 98a9c8c3ba13dfc3df8e6d2a126d2fa4e4621e9c (patch) | |
tree | 3a3fa59159ba65160df4ae600725eddcc8782a17 | |
parent | 61a021a0700c22ee527d73d92f9acb109ff478f8 (diff) |
x86, mce: trivial clean up for mce-inject.c
Fix for:
WARNING: Use #include <linux/uaccess.h> instead of <asm/uaccess.h>
+#include <asm/uaccess.h>
WARNING: usage of NR_CPUS is often wrong - consider using cpu_possible(), num_possible_cpus(), for_each_possible_cpu(), etc
+ if (m.cpu >= NR_CPUS || !cpu_online(m.cpu))
ERROR: trailing whitespace
+/* $
Signed-off-by: Hidetoshi Seto <seto.hidetoshi@jp.fujitsu.com>
Cc: Andi Kleen <andi@firstfloor.org>
Signed-off-by: H. Peter Anvin <hpa@zytor.com>
-rw-r--r-- | arch/x86/kernel/cpu/mcheck/mce-inject.c | 4 |
1 files changed, 2 insertions, 2 deletions
diff --git a/arch/x86/kernel/cpu/mcheck/mce-inject.c b/arch/x86/kernel/cpu/mcheck/mce-inject.c index 673c72855022..7b3a5428396a 100644 --- a/arch/x86/kernel/cpu/mcheck/mce-inject.c +++ b/arch/x86/kernel/cpu/mcheck/mce-inject.c | |||
@@ -11,13 +11,13 @@ | |||
11 | * Andi Kleen | 11 | * Andi Kleen |
12 | * Ying Huang | 12 | * Ying Huang |
13 | */ | 13 | */ |
14 | #include <linux/uaccess.h> | ||
14 | #include <linux/module.h> | 15 | #include <linux/module.h> |
15 | #include <linux/timer.h> | 16 | #include <linux/timer.h> |
16 | #include <linux/kernel.h> | 17 | #include <linux/kernel.h> |
17 | #include <linux/string.h> | 18 | #include <linux/string.h> |
18 | #include <linux/fs.h> | 19 | #include <linux/fs.h> |
19 | #include <linux/smp.h> | 20 | #include <linux/smp.h> |
20 | #include <asm/uaccess.h> | ||
21 | #include <asm/mce.h> | 21 | #include <asm/mce.h> |
22 | 22 | ||
23 | /* Update fake mce registers on current CPU. */ | 23 | /* Update fake mce registers on current CPU. */ |
@@ -93,7 +93,7 @@ static ssize_t mce_write(struct file *filp, const char __user *ubuf, | |||
93 | if (copy_from_user(&m, ubuf, usize)) | 93 | if (copy_from_user(&m, ubuf, usize)) |
94 | return -EFAULT; | 94 | return -EFAULT; |
95 | 95 | ||
96 | if (m.cpu >= NR_CPUS || !cpu_online(m.cpu)) | 96 | if (m.cpu >= num_possible_cpus() || !cpu_online(m.cpu)) |
97 | return -EINVAL; | 97 | return -EINVAL; |
98 | 98 | ||
99 | dm = kmalloc(sizeof(struct delayed_mce), GFP_KERNEL); | 99 | dm = kmalloc(sizeof(struct delayed_mce), GFP_KERNEL); |